  2. Defence Honours and Awards Tribunal Update

    The Defence Honours and Awards Tribunal was established in July 2008. The Tribunal is an independent body which reviews Defence honours and awards issues at the direction of Government, through the Parliamentary Secretary for Defence Support, the Hon Dr Mike Kelly AM MP. The Tribunal may also review individual entitlements. ...

  3. Operation Catalyst

    Operation CATALYST was the Australian Defence Force's contribution to the US-led Multinational Force effort to create a secure and stable environment in Iraq and to assist with national recovery programs. ...
